got some epson wf3520 printers here....cracking printer for speed and quality but
the carts are really small....just refilled for the 5th time since we got em....:rolleyes:

i have not seen bigger sized ones for this printer....so i,m thinking ciss....are they really that bad for air locks ??

CISS are hit and miss, and is more to go wrong - the printer was not designed to pull ink through tubes from big remote tanks. You may be better looking for a new printer which can get bigger carts - the Epson WF Pro printers can get 100ml refill carts, or trade in your collection of printers and go wide format and get 300ml refill carts!
